Ensures effective collection of an assigned group of delinquent accounts to minimize losses to the Bank, including escalated or large payment delinquencies. Provides excellent customer service and helps to Counsels customers regarding credit issues as necessary.
Handles escalations/disputes and interprets documents/requests against applicable policies. Uses an online collections system to accurately document customer account information and contact customers for repayment.
Explores new negotiating techniques that improve collection efforts. May train more junior associates.
Educates customers on financial alternatives and the ramifications of their actions through counseling practices.
Ability to manage the current SLA and maintain appropriate contact volume. Ability to maintain control over all conversations. Ability to work with all departments. Ability to assist supervisor and manager in day to day activities/reports.
